How does the story of David relate to the doctrine of God's sovereignty?

Answered in 1 source

The story of David showcases God's sovereignty in choosing and working through individuals for His divine purposes.

David’s story is rich with illustrations of God's sovereignty as He selects David for the kingship over Israel, despite his humble beginnings. This divine selection emphasizes God's control over earthly kingdoms and His purposes unfolding through flawed humanity. Even when David faces dangers from Saul, his tumultuous path leads him to eventual kingship, redefining God's plans in opposition to human actions. The lesson here is that despite our circumstances, God's purposes prevail, and He employs every situation to fulfill His will. This reflects the broader Reformed belief in God's sovereignty, where every event is orchestrated under His divine authority for the culmination of His redemptive plan.
Scripture References: 1 Samuel 16:1-13, Romans 8:28
